# Xing Ren

### Armeniacae Semen

_bitter, slightly warm, slightly toxic_

#### PRIMARY FUNCTION:

_**Relieve Cough and Wheeze**_

CLASSICAL MANIFESTATIONS:
- Cough

Xing Ren is bitter, slightly toxic, and slightly warm. It enters the
lung and large intestine systems. To treat cough.
As a seed, Xing Ren is also useful to lubricate the intestines for
treating constipation.

**Channels:** lung, large intestine

**Contraindications:** do not prescribe Xing Ren to patients
with patterns due to deficiency of yin
